LINGUISTICS
An Interdisciplinary Journal of Language Sciences
Editor: Wolfgang Klein
ISSN: 0024-3949
Linguistics is available online to institutional subscribers of the
print version at no additional cost. If you are a subscriber and would
like to register for this free service, please contact us at
o-journals at deGruyter.com for more information.
Volume 40, Issue 2 (2002)
IN THIS ISSUE
DAVID EDDINGTON
Why quantitative?
JOSE IGNACIO HUALDE AND MONICA PRIETO
On the diphtong/hiatus contrast in Spanish: some experimental results
ALBERTO DOMINGUEZ; JUAN SEGUI; AND FERNANDO CUETOS
The time-course of inflexional morphological priming
RENA TORRES CACOULLOS
Le: from pronoun to verbal intensifier
TIMOTHY L. FACE
Spanish evidence for pitch-accent structure
ERIK W. WILLIS
Is there a Spanish imperative intonation revisited: local considerations
ZSUZSANNA BARKANYI
A fresh look at quantity sensitivity in Spanish
DAVID EDDINGTON
Spanish diminutive formation without rules or constraints
EMILIA ALONSO MARKS, DANNY R. MOATES, Z.S. BOND, AND VERNA STOCKMAL
Word reconstruction and consonant features in English and Spanish
KIMBERLY L. GEESLIN
Semantic transparency as a predictor of copula choice in second-language
acquistition
